    Archeologists and university students recently discovered an ancient gold necklace during an excavation project in Vatnsfjördur in Ísafjardardjúp in the West Fjords, which has been ongoing for the past eight summers. Scientists from different fields participate in the project, along with international university students, ruv.is reports. Vatnsfjördur was settled early in the Settlement Era, which sources state began in the 9th century AD, and later became the site of a manor and a chieftain's residence. Many beautiful objects have been excavated in the course of the project.

    MAKHACHKALA - Chechen warlord Ruslan Gelayev has been killed in a clash with two border guards in the mountains of Dagestan, the Federal Security Service confirmed on Monday. The body of the notorious field commander was found in the snow some 100 meters away from the bodies of two soldiers he had killed before the end. One of the most infamous Chechen filed commanders - Ruslan (also known as Khamzat) Gelayev was killed in the mountains of Dagestan on Saturday.
